Melt coconut oil in saucepan over medium-high heat. Stir in apples, cinnamon, and cardamom. Cook 4 minutes, stirring occasionally, or until tender. Remove cooked apples from saucepan and set aside.
Prepare oatmeal:
Pour almond milk or water into same saucepan. Bring to a boil and then reduce heat to medium-low. Stir in Hearty Grains & Seeds cereal, tahini, and salt. Cook 4 minutes, or until oats soften to desired consistency. Stir in half of the cooked apples.
Serve:
Transfer cooked cereal mixture to bowls and top with remaining apples.
Top with pomegranate, pecans, tahini, maple syrup, and cinnamon if desired.

Storage: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at in a small pot with a splash of milk or water to loosen the texture. For best results, add fresh toppings just before serving.
